Harold Russell "rusty" Johnson 1927 — 2008
Born on Jun 1, 1927 to Harold Archie Johnson and Bessie Marian Garfield Dougherty. Harold Russell "rusty" Johnson passed away on Jan 1, 2008, at the age of 80 and was buried in Syracuse Cemetery in Syracuse, KS. Harold Russell "rusty" Johnson was married to Betty Jean O'brate Johnson and had 1 children: Linda Jean Johnson.
